We are given that the duck traveled a total distance of
[tex]$$97.8 \text{ miles}$$[/tex]
in
[tex]$$1.5 \text{ hours}.$$[/tex]
To find the distance traveled in one hour, we set up the following proportion:
[tex]$$\text{Distance in one hour} = \frac{\text{Total Distance}}{\text{Total Time}}.$$[/tex]
Substituting the given values, we have:
[tex]$$\text{Distance in one hour} = \frac{97.8 \text{ miles}}{1.5 \text{ hours}}.$$[/tex]
Carrying out the division:
[tex]$$\frac{97.8}{1.5} = 65.2 \text{ miles}.$$[/tex]
Thus, the duck traveled
[tex]$$65.2 \text{ miles in one hour}.$$[/tex]
